Paula Bresnahan, MSPT Bio Photo 

Name: Paula Bresnahan
Graduate: Boston College, University of Miami in Coral Gables, FL
Credentials: BA, MSPT, CSCS

Hobbies/Interests:

 

Paula originally began working at SPTA, as an aide and a billing assistant, after graduating from Boston College in 1995.  She went on to earn her Master's degree in P.T.  at the University of Miami and returned to SPTA as a physical therapist in 2000.  She is also a certified strength and conditioning specialist through the NSCA. 

 

Paula enjoys treating a variety of orthopedic diagnoses.  Her experiences in and out of the PT clinic have highlighted the sacroiliac joint, shoulder, and knee and challenged her to find optimal treatment techniques for each individual patient.  Paula works in our Acton, Lexington, and Sudbury locations.   

 

In her free time, you'll find Paula spending time with family and friends.  She enjoys jogging, skiing, snowboarding, golfing, and watching most any sport!  She ran the 2006 Boston Marathon as well as several other half marathons.

 

Melanie Maguire Bio Photo 
Name: Melanie Maguire Kern
Graduate: University of Massachusetts in Amherst, University of Miami in Coral Gables, FL
Credentials: BS Exercise Science, MSPT, CSCS
 
Hobbies/Interests:
 

Melanie has been practicing in outpatient sports and orthopedic physical therapy since graduating with her Master’s degree in December of 1999.  Melanie treats a wide variety of orthopedic and sports injuries. Most of her post graduate course work and interests have focused on shoulder, knee and spine rehabilitation. Melanie likes to incorporate techniques such as graston / SASTM (http://www.grastontechnique.com/ ) and kinesiotaping (http://www.kinesiotaping.com/kinesio/method.html ) into her treatments to facilitate faster healing along with comprehensive exercise programs.  Melanie is also a Certified Strength and Conditioning Specialist (CSCS) through the National Strength and Conditioning Association.  

 

Melanie splits her time between the Lexington and Acton offices. In her spare time, Melanie enjoys exercising, traveling and spending time with her husband, family and friends.

 

 

Mark Gorman Bio Photo 
Name: Mark Gorman
Graduate: Northeastern University
Credentials: BS, DPT, CSCS
 
Hobbies/Interests:
 
Mark graduated from Northeastern University with a BS in Rehabilitation Science and a Doctorate in Physical Therapy.  He is also a Certified Strength and Conditioning Specialist (CSCS) through the National Strength and Conditioning Association (NSCA). He sees patients in both the Lexington and Acton offices. Mark enjoys working with a variety of patients and has clinical concentration in musculoskeletal and spine injuries in the sports and orthopedic populations. His clinical experiences have included acute care, acute rehabilitation as well as a variety of outpatient physical therapy clinics.   Mark also has experience as a lab instructor for the gross anatomy course at Northeastern University.
 
In his free time Mark enjoys spending time with his wife.
